Victory Memorial Gardens is located in Wagga Wagga, NSW, on Lake (Wollundry lagoon) in Wallendry lagoon, a city park with an area of about 2 hectares.
Victory Memorial Gardens was founded in 1925 to commemorate the soldiers who fought bravely and died honorably in World War I. There are many wild animals living here, including ducks, geese, swans and all kinds of waterfowl.
